Duties and Responsibilities

  • Perform personal assistance services for residents as dictated by their ISP's examples that includes
  • Following the care plan as directed by lead
  • Assisting with bathing and grooming- includes: Washing and conditioning hair, finger and toenail care, brush teeth or dentures, shower assistance and more
  • Preparing food — it is very important for residents to maintain proper nutrition
  • Medication reminders- caregivers must assure that medications are taken at the correct time as directed by doctor
  • Clean all areas of the residents living space- including sweeping, mopping, dusting, dishwashing, linen changing and laundry
  • Transferring Residents- this refers to transferring the client from chairs, from the toilet, from the bed and in some cases from the company vehicle
  • It is imperative to assist residents with toileting to avoid infections
  • Depending on position determines if transporting residents per their need is included in responsibilities
  • Monitoring changes in resident's health- when following the care plan, the administrator/lead will want to know if there are any changes in health that are concerning and that may need medical attention
  • Companionship — possibly the most important of all caregiver duties, caregivers will be with the resident all day and it's mutually beneficial if they enjoy each other's company.
